This is a first edition of Matteh Dan which has been considered Rabbi David Nieto's magnum opus. Organized in the form of a dialogue in five parts, the book acts as a defense of Rabbinic Judaism and the Jewish Oral Law against the views of the Karaites and theological/ ideological attacks during the period from some ex-marranos. In doing so Neito provides a detailed analysis of the nature of Talmudic disputes between the rabbis of the Mishnah and Gemarah. Nieto regarded this work as a supplement to the famous "Kuzari" of Judah Halevi, the purpose of which was to demonstrate the veracity of the Written Law, while the object of his own work was to prove the validity of the Oral Law. In parallel fashion to the original Sefer Ha-Kuzari, which took the form of a supposed dialogue between a rabbi and the pagan King of the Khazars, Nieto's work also takes the form of a dialogue. The first unpaginated section includes a dedication statement and a preface.

Text in Spanish, in a two column format. Historiated woodcut initials, decorative headpieces, tailpieces and vignettes throughout the text, as well as a number of tables, charts, calendars and some small illustrated figures.

David Nieto (1654 – 1728) was a Sephardic rabbi who was an acclaimed multidisciplinary scholar. He served as head of the Spanish and Portuguese Jewish community in London from 1704 until the time of his death. He was succeeded by his son, Isaac Nieto.

* Reference: Roth, "Magna Bibliotheca Anglo-Judaica". p.330 B11, #10.
The book was also published in a bilingual Spanish-Hebrew edition, with two title pages, printed the same year as this edition.
